THE CHALLENGE

The U-M Division of Public Safety & Security needed an engaging, cohesive event identity and visual toolkit to make the quarterly new hire orientation feel welcoming, build immediate culture, and present complex information in a digestible format.

Three smiling University of Michigan DPSS employees standing together at an event, holding

New employees holding up the passports.

THE APPROACH

I created a scalable brand identity and event assets designed around engagement. Materials included "passports" for collecting stamps at information tables, a presentation template, agenda, signage and other physical assets. This gave the event a welcoming, accessible atmosphere that can carry into future events.
